admin.py
from django.contrib import admin from .models import * admin.site.register(Company) admin.site.register(Person)
admin.pyは、adminページで表示するテーブルの設定などを行うファイルです。
と記入することでadminページに対象のテーブルが表示されるようになります。
上の例では、models.pyのCompanyクラスとPersonクラスをadminページに表示させています。
adminページはデフォルトのローカル環境ならhttp://127.0.0.1:8002/admin/にアクセスすることで開くことができます。
ファイルの先頭でmodels.pyの読み込み忘れには注意してください。
これで表示されない場合は、settings.pyでアプリケーションの追加をできていないかもしれないので確認してください。
admin.site.register(models.py内のクラス名)
と記入することでadminページに対象のテーブルが表示されるようになります。
上の例では、models.pyのCompanyクラスとPersonクラスをadminページに表示させています。
adminページはデフォルトのローカル環境ならhttp://127.0.0.1:8002/admin/にアクセスすることで開くことができます。
ファイルの先頭でmodels.pyの読み込み忘れには注意してください。
これで表示されない場合は、settings.pyでアプリケーションの追加をできていないかもしれないので確認してください。